Coatings on Mg alloys and their mechanical properties: A review

Abstract:

Poor corrosion resistance is a serious drawback of Mg alloys, restricting their practical applications. Coating is one of the effective techniques for improvement in the poor corrosion resistance. In this paper, the coating processes for Mg alloys so far developed are reviewed. Among several processes, the coating processes based on mechanical energy, including metal forming, are attractive because the corrosion resistance and formability of Mg alloys are simultaneously improved.
